polka

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un polka has 2 senses
  1. polka - music performed for dancing the polka
    --1 is a kind of
    dance music, danceroom music, ballroom music
  2. polka - a Bohemian dance with 3 steps and a hop in fast time
    --2 is a kind of
    folk dancing, folk dance

Definitions from the Web

Polka

Noun

1. A lively dance of Bohemian origin in duple time, typically performed in quick triple steps with a hop in between.

Example sentence: The couple twirled and bounced energetically as they danced the polka.

Verb

1. To dance the polka.

Example sentence: The band started playing and everyone rushed to polka around the room.

Adjective

1. Relating to or characteristic of the polka dance.

Example sentence: She wore a polka skirt and matching shoes to the polka event.
